After-hours access to the server room at Calloway Point is limited to named engineers on the standing roster held at the facilities desk. Anyone else, including managers, requires written approval from the infrastructure lead before 17:00 on the day of the visit. Log every entry and exit in the red ledger, noting time and purpose. Escorted visitors must never be left alone inside, and the door must latch fully on exit. The keypad on the server-room door accepts the code below.

staff pass of kawip-hawef = bdg-QLP-2

## Vendored Fonts — Signing

All third-party fonts bundled in Glyphwarden builds must be vendored under `assets/fonts/vendor/` with their license files. Support: if a customer reports a tampered-font warning, confirm the font archive hash matches the release manifest before escalating. Do not swap fonts post-build; the signer covers the whole bundle. Re-sign only via the Brindlemoor pipeline. Verification requires the current signing key, shown below.

deploy key for kajof-fajop: bky6_gDHw9Q

Review comment on shrinkray, the batch image-resize CLI: the worker pool sizing here is hardcoded inline, which is why the Olverton incident page last week pointed at the wrong module. Please hoist all tunables into the constants block so on-call can correlate alerts with one file. Also, the memory ceiling should account for the decode buffer, not just the output plane. I verified the numbers against the soak run. The corrected constants should read as follows.

tuning constants:
BUDGETS = {
    "druath": 240,
    "lamwyn": 180,
    "silael": 275,
}